Ghogan - Nanoor, Birbhum
Ghogan is a village situated in the Nanoor subdivision of Birbhum district, West Bengal. Barasaota ser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ghogan village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ghogan is 317661. The village covers a total geographical area of 80.4 hectares and falls under the 731301 pincode. Bolpur is the nearest town, located about 17 km away.
Ghogan village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Ghogan
As per Census 2011, Ghogan village has a total population of 160 people, consisting of 81 males and 79 females. The village has 42 households and a sex ratio of 975 females per 1,000 males. There are 22 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 108 literate and 52 illiterate residents. Additionally, 65 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Ghogan
Ghogan is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Prantik, while the nearest airport is Kazi Nazrul Islam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 49.0 km.
